Is Oku Kannabe snowsure?
The snowiest week in Oku Kannabe is week 4 of January. There are typically 4.3 snowy days during this week with 30 cm of snowfall. Check out the Oku Kannabe Snow History graphs below. Select any week of the year to see the typical Ski Conditions, Snowfall Amount and Temperature based on nowcast weather data over the last 11 years.Average monthly snow in Oku Kannabe
| Month | Snow amount (week) | Snow days (week) |
|---|---|---|
| December | 13 cm | 2.5 days |
| January | 22 cm | 4.1 days |
| February | 16 cm | 3.5 days |
| March | 5 cm | 1.6 days |
| April | 0 cm | 0.2 days |
Average Snow and Weather Conditions in Oku Kannabe during August (week 1):
The average snowfall forecast during week 1 of August for Oku Kannabe is 0 cm. There are typically 0.0 snowy days during this week. Oku Kannabe prevailing weather and snow conditions during the first week of August at the middle elevation of the ski area at 625m, based on historical averages over the last 18 years: At this time of year the normal freezing level (5158m) is a long way above the middle elevation of Oku Kannabe. Snowfall is very unlikely in Oku Kannabe at the start of August but in a typical year there are a couple of wet days during this week of August. Warm daytime temperatures in Oku Kannabe during week one of August. The average temperature range is between 24.1°C and 25.3°C at the middle elevation. Expect the sun to shine on three out of seven days. Generally light winds (average 10km/h).
